A childhood dream.

Rewind 30-ish years and most of my childhood weekends were spent building pretend television cameras from old cardboard boxes.

A bit embarrassing, I know. But as an eager and excitable 7-year-old, I was absolutely captivated by the behind-the-scenes creativity of TV shows like Blue Peter, Live & Kicking, Doctor Who, Noel's House Party and the Generation Game.

Enthralled by the glitz and glamour of the BBC's Television Centre in West London and ITV's studios on the capital's Southbank, I set about forging a career in TV.

My dream was to one day become a live television director.

Michael Wood, a former BBC & ITV Television Director, and Managing Director of Embrace Video Ltd.

Whizz forwards again and after years of hard work, patience and persistent effort, I became one of the BBC's youngest television directors, aged just 22.

After honing my craft at the BBC's studios in Birmingham, I moved up to Leeds where I went on to spend the next 13 years delivering the creative vision behind some of television's most-watched shows.

I've had the pleasure of working on BBC News, Panorama, Children in Need, the Politics Show, Inside Out, ITV News, Late Kick Off and the Super League Show to name just a few.

I've directed jaw-dropping valuations on the Antiques Roadshow as well as live breaking news on the BBC News Channel. I've also vision mixed and directed live news for ITV Central in Birmingham.

It was a huge honour to meet stars like: Ricky Gervais, Mel B, Brian Blessed, Sophie Raworth, Owain Wyn Evans, Michael Vaughan, the Chuckle Brothers, Barry Humphries, Bruce Forsyth, Angellica Bell, magician Dynamo, and boy band McFly.

If they were presenting a show I was directing, my role involved speaking to them via an earpiece from the control room (known as the gallery), directing them to look at different cameras, instructing them to talk to exact timings, and letting them know about any last-minute changes to the live running order.

If they were appearing on a television programme as a guest, I was responsible for looking after them in the studio, making sure they were comfortable and relaxed, and putting them at ease on camera.

From live television to corporate video production.

In 2020, amid the global Coronavirus pandemic, I decided to leave the BBC and pursue a career in video production.

I'd had an absolutely fantastic experience at the BBC but I was keen to embark on a new challenge and apply my broadcast production skills to a new role.

Video was quite clearly becoming an increasingly popular medium for businesses and organisations to use as part of their marketing strategies. But for many companies, producing video content felt overwhelming and the thought of appearing on camera to promote their business was proving frightening.

"Confusing, time-consuming, expensive, too technical and scary". These were all barriers which were preventing amazing companies from shouting about their fantastic work and growing their businesses through the power of video.

I wanted to support businesses on their journey into the brave new world of video by drawing on my unique combination of broadcast experience and digital production skills.

In 2021 I established Embrace Video. It's mission was simple: To help businesses overcome the overwhelm of video and to tell their stories through the power of film.

The aim of my smartphone video training courses is to help in-house marketing, communications and sales teams to develop the skills, knowledge and confidence to create professional-looking video content using just their smartphones.

Topics I cover on the workshop include how to:

  • Develop a successful video strategy
  • Structure, storyboard and script engaging video content
  • Capture high-quality video and audio using just your smartphone
  • Edit powerful video content using simple, inexpensive smartphone apps
  • Talk and present to the camera comfortably and confidently
  • Get the best out of interviewees on camera

I cater for all ability levels - from those who have never picked up a camera before, to people who create videos regularly and would like to learn how to take their content to the next level.

I typically deliver a full day of training (9.30am-4.30pm) to small groups of the organisation's in-house marketing, communications and sales teams, usually at the company's own premises.
